The next step in the DIY carpenter bee trap is to attach the mason jar to the bottom of the trap. Using a 1/2" titanium or cobalt drill bit designed for drilling into metal, drill a 1/2" hole in the center of the mason jar lid as shown below. So of course the bugs are out and about too! In particular, there has been an increase in the …Sep 1, 2023 · The first step is to trim your 4×4 down to the correct size. For our design, we cut our 4×4 to five inches long. So the resulting piece is a rectangle that measures 4 x 4 x 5 inches. Once they are cut to size, use the 3/4 inch drill bit to create a hole in the center of one of the small sides (one of the 4×4 sides). Only need one block of wood fo...Hi guys, In this video i will show you that how can you make A trap for Fly, Bees and Gian Bee from a Plastic bottle.Because near the Honeycomb It's very he...Step 3: Drilling the Holes. 1) Drill the main hole in the bottom of the trap. Use a 3/4" bit. 2) Drill 1/2" holes in all 4 sides of the trap, starting about an inch from the bottom and drilled at a 45 degree angle upwards. BEST SELLERS …Jun 5, 2023 · How to Make a Carpenter Bee Trap: To begin, you will need to drill a hole in the center of your 4×4. We used a 15/16 inch drill bit, however, you can use one that is 1 inch or a little under. Drill your hole about 5 inches deep. TIP: Wrap masking tape around your drill bit at the 5-inch mark. Citrus oil is a safe, natural repellent that carpenter bees dislike, and you can easily make your own at home. Cut up a selection of peels from a variety of citrus fruits, place in a pan, and cover with water.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for 10 minutes.
